Plot:

In the face of impending disaster, Dr. Katherine Miller embarks on a desperate mission to protect the planet from catastrophic meteor impacts. As a renowned astrophysicist, she utilizes her intellect and cutting-edge technology in a relentless fight against time. The film presents a tense atmosphere as Dr. Miller navigates the complexities of space exploration and geopolitical intrigue while simultaneously grappling with personal sacrifices.The story explores themes of human resilience, scientific curiosity, and global cooperation amidst overwhelming odds. As Dr. Miller works tirelessly to devise a plan that could safeguard humanity's future, viewers are reminded of the power of the human spirit in the face of seemingly insurmountable challenges. With gripping cinematography and thought-provoking dialogue, this movie offers an enthralling tale of scientific ingenuity and courage against the backdrop of a potential cosmic catastrophe.
